In the reaction of 1,3-dimethyl-pyrazole-5-carboxylic acid (HL) with M(OAc)2?4H2O, (M = Cu, Co) two novel complexes have been prepared, square-planar [CuL2(H2O)2] and octahedral [CoL2(MeOH)4]. The crystal structures have been determined by single-crystal X-ray diffraction. In both complexes the deprotonated acid displays monodentate coordination to the metal ions. According to the results of CSD survey this is the first structural report on the metal complexes with N1-substituted pyrazole-5-carboxylic ligand.
